Turnquist, Elsie B. Our beautiful, talented mother, grandmother and great grandmother packed up her watercolors and brushes and set off just before the snowstorm to join her ever-adventurous late husband Ralph on a new journey. Although her balance for nearly 98 years remained steady, an unexpected fall, broken hip and surgery proved too challenging; yet she was circled by love at the end. We are grateful to have had her wisdom, wonder at nature's beauty, enthusiasm and generosity for so long. Survived and treasured by Rolf and Liz; Trude, Alan and Chick; Ayla and Tim; Adi and Ellison; T. Cody and Meredith; Casmir and Kieran; Sydney and Ben. Heartfelt thanks to Friendship Village staff for 16 years of care, Dr. Ron Kaufman, Todd Lunda, Dr. Bernie Rottach, (our genie) Jeanne, and ICU nurses Brooke and Christine. A Celebration of Life will be held this summer. Memorials to the Minnesota Arboretum (Marion Andrus Center) and Friendship Village EAF. Bradshaw Green Cremation 651-439-5511
